About Reddestone, New South Wales

Reddestone is a locality in the Glen Innes Severn Shire Council local government area of New South Wales, Australia. It is a small community with a population of 56. The locality covers an area of 144.5 km², giving a population density of about 0.4 people per km². It sits at an elevation of around 1025 m above sea level. It lies approximately 479 km north of Sydney. Reddestone is located at 29.5815°S, 151.6556°E. It observes Australian Eastern Time (AEST/AEDT). Postcode: 2370. The Australian Bureau of Statistics classifies the area as Outer Regional Australia.
